Watching both play in HS, they dont seem to be all that similar. McGary runs the floor and really prefers to be down low and a banger. He is also a much better rebounder than McRoberts. Josh was a very solid player, but his skill set was so much more 6-6 than 6-10. McGarys skill set is very much that of 6-10.swamisez;954110 wrote:He fits better at Michigan than Duke. The weekend I saw McGary he was facing up constantly from 15-18. Often took off balance runners, and sought backside rebounds instead of banging. Maybe he was showcasing other skills when I saw him, I don't know? My feeling was that he was more of a small forward in a power forward body.
Of course my sample size was quite small.
